Race Description
A new 5 mile road race in Essex, undulating rural route, startng and finishing in Great Notley Business Park, and taking in the village of Rayne, and the delightful Flitch Way. UKA Athletics Permit and official course measurement. Goody Bag with Tee Shirt to all finishers, Individual Trophies to category winners, and Team Trophies. Sorry no wheelchairs. No dogs or bicycles. Refreshments. Donation to Helen Rollason Cancer Charity.
